Heat Cramps
Anyone suffering from heat cramps experiencing painful
contractions of muscles , due to overheating . The Slippens after a violent
effort , with much sweating . You feel it in the muscles used and / or abdominal
muscles .
What can you do to heat cramps ?
- Slightly salty food
- Rest to cool down
- Drink a glass of water to which a teaspoon of salt added .
- Get out of the Sun
- Drink cold drinks
Heat stroke or heat exhaustion
If too much body water is lost , we speak
of a hiiteberoerte . There may be a shock may occur because the blood pressure
drops too much . Symptoms can occur suddenly and are often the result of heavy
sweating and inadequate drinking.
Symptoms of hiiteberoerte may be ;
- Increased body temperature
- Dizziness
- Accelerated heartbeat
- Low blood pressure
- Gray facial color
- Nausea
- Cold , clammy skin
What can you do for heat stroke ?
- Get the victim out of the sun , and bring him up in a room with air conditioning.
- Loosen clothing or pull it out
- Lay the victim down with legs slightly elevated
- Give cold water or a sports drink with electrolytes
- Keep the victim in the eye
Sunstroke or heat stroke
Of a heat stroke occurs when there is a high
body temperature . The temperature rises to dangerous levels of above 42 degrees
Celsius . At such high temperatures can damage brain occur . People who sweat
little more likely to walk to walk . In the elderly fainting the first symptom
of heat stroke .
Risk factors for getting a sunstroke ;
- Heavy physical activity at high temperatures
- Alcohol
- Dehydration
- Cardiac disorders
- Use of certain medications
Symptoms sunstroke
- Accelerated heartbeat
- Rapid shallow breathing
- Disturbed blood pressure ( too high or too low)
- Very hot , dry skin
- Dizziness
- Severe headache
- Weakness
- Disorientation , Confusion
- Convulsions or become unconscious gain
heat stroke is suspected seek medical attention
Once the suspicion that
someone has suffered a heat stroke , should immediately seek medical attention.
It is also important to the person to get out of the sun , preferably in an air
-cooled space and bring him / her to sponges awaiting help from a
doctor.
